
The basin-like valley of Cwm Idwal is in the Glyderau range of mountains in Snowdonia National Park. This stunningly beautiful location (in the light!) is blessed with high crags, rock slabs and scree slopes – and is popular with rock climbers and hill walkers as well as geologists and botanists. This wild camping spot is close to the edge of Llyn Idwal, a small but prominent mountain lake and popular wild swimming / bathing spot. Its pretty dark here so a clear night presents stargazing opportunities and that feeling of being away from it all!
